#700ca5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#700ca5 is composed of 43.9% red, 4.7% green and 64.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 32.1% cyan, 92.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 35.3% black. It has a hue angle of 279.2 degrees, a saturation of 86.4% and a lightness of 34.7%. #700ca5 color hex could be obtained by blending #e018ff with #00004b.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

Shades and Tints of #700ca5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f8edf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#700ca5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#59575a is the less saturated color, while #7205ac is the most saturated one.
